PSR-1:相互に機能を連携させるための規約

ファイル

PHPコードは<?php ?>タグか<?= ?>を使用すること

PHPコードではBOMなしのUTF-8で使用する

ファイルはクラスや関数などの定義のみのファイルとそれ以外の副作用のファイルは分割して管理すること


名前空間とクラス

PSR-0に準拠

クラス名はStudlyCapsで宣言する

PHP5.3以降は名前空間を使用する、PHP5.2では擬似名前空間を使用する


定数、プロパティメソッド

定数は全て大文字で記述し、アンダースコアで単語を区切る

メソッド名はcamelCaseで宣言する

プロパティ名はcamelCase、StudlyCaps、under_scoreで記述



最終更新:2012年12月15日 09:41